Tollywood drugs case: Actor Rana Daggubati appears before ED
Tollywood actor Rana Daggubati on Wednesday appeared before the Enforcement Directorate (ED) in connection with a money laundering probe linked to a 2017 drug case.
The ‘Baahubali’ fame actor reached the ED office here around 10 a.m. and walked in as a posse of security personnel escorted him through a battery of media lensmen vying with each other to capture the moment.
Rana is likely to be questioned by ED sleuths about his bank details and financial transactions as part of the probe into suspected links of some celebrities with the accused involved in the case.
Rana is the fifth Tollywood personality to appear before ED. Director Puri Jagannadh and actors Charmee Kaur, Rakul Preet Singh and Nandu were questioned since August 31.
The ED had last month issued notices to 10 persons connected to Tollywood and two others including a private club manager as part of a money laundering probe linked to the case related to the smuggling of ‘Class A’ narcotic substances, including LSD and MDMA.
Nandu was questioned for more than eight hours on Tuesday. Main accused in the case Calvin Mascarenhas and two others were also grilled by the ED sleuths on Tuesday.
Actors Ravi Teja, Navdeep. Mumaith Khan, Tanish and Ravi Teja’s driver Srinivas have also been summoned by the ED in connection the drugs racket which was busted with the arrest of drug peddlers in 2017.
Rana and Rakul Preet did not figure in the list of Tollywood celebrities questioned by the Special Investigation Team (SIT) of Telangana’s prohibition and excise department in 2017.
However, Rakul Preet was questioned by the Narcotics Control Bureau, Mumbai, last year in an alleged drugs nexus in Bollywood.
The drugs racket was busted on July 2, 2017 when customs officials arrested Calvin Mascarenhas, a musician, and two others and seized drugs worth Rs 30 lakh from their possession.
They had reportedly told the investigators that they are supplying drugs to film celebrities, software engineers, and even students of some corporate schools. Mobile numbers of some Tollywood celebrities were allegedly found in their contact lists.
The excise department had constituted SIT for a comprehensive probe. A total of 12 cases were registered, 30 people were arrested while 62 individuals including 11 people connected with Tollywood were examined by the SIT under section 67 of the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ances (NDPS) Act and section 161 of Criminal Procedure Code.
The SIT had collected blood, hair, nail and other samples from some of those who appeared before it for question and sent them for analysis.
The SIT filed charge sheet in eight out of 12 cases. It, however, gave clean chit to the film personalities who were questioned as part of the investigation.

Asha Bhosle’s son says last respects to be paid at residence in Lower Parel, followed by last rites at Shivaji Park

Mumbai, April 12: Legendary playback singer Asha Bhosle’s son Anand Bhosle has shared that the last respects will be held at her residence in Lower Parel.
Speaking to the media, he said, “My mother passed away today. People can pay their last respects to her at 11:00 am tomorrow at Casa Grande, Lower Parel, where she lived. Her last rites will be performed at 4 pm tomorrow at Shivaji Park”.
Her elder sister, Lata Mangeshkar, who was a Bharat Ratna awardee was also cremated at the Shivaji Park in 2022.
Asha Bhosle passed away at the age of 93 in Mumbai on Sunday. The singer was admitted to the Breach Candy Hospital on Saturday. Ashish Shelar, the Culture Minister of Maharashtra made the announcement outside the hospital. Her last rites will be held at Shivaji Park on Monday at 4:00 pm.
One of the most influential singers of her time, Asha Bhosle, sang her first song as a playback for the 1943 Marathi drama ‘Majha Bal’. She is known for lending her voice to some noteworthy numbers such as ‘Chura Liya Hai Tumne Jo Dil Ko’, ‘Do Lafzon Ki Hai Dil Ki Kahani’, ‘Kya Ghazab Karte Ho Ji’, ‘O Haseena Zulfonwale Jane Jahan’, and ‘Ye Ladka Hay Allah Kaisa Hai Diwana’, to name just a few. Along with Hindi, she has sung in around 20 Indian and foreign languages.
In 2006, Asha Bhosle herself disclosed that she has almost 12,000 songs to her credit. During her tenure as a singer spanning several decades, Asha Bhosle has worked with many acclaimed music composers such as Shankar-Jaikishan, RD Burman, OP Nayyar, Ilaiyaraaja, Bappi Lahiri, and AR Rahman. She received numerous awards throughout her career for many of her noteworthy songs. The singer was given the prestigious Dadasaheb Phalke Award back in 2000, followed by a Padma Vibhushan in 2008.

Mumbai: Pan-India Hawala Trail Exposes Chilling Conspiracy Behind Rohit Shetty House Firing Case

Mumbai: A breakthrough has emerged in the investigation into the firing incident outside filmmaker Rohit Shetty’s residence in Mumbai, with Crime Branch sources indicating that the attack was financed entirely through hawala channels.
According to investigators, the accused involved in recruiting the shooters, identified as Golu Pandit, received funds via an illegal hawala network rather than through formal banking systems. The money was allegedly routed through multiple locations, including Nepal, Delhi, and Uttar Pradesh.
Sources further revealed that the financial operations were orchestrated by Arju Bishnoi, an operator linked to the Bishnoi gang. The gang reportedly used its network to channel funds and execute the plan.
Golu Pandit is said to have played a crucial role in the conspiracy. He not only recruited the shooters but also arranged shelter, logistics, and other support required for carrying out the attack. Preliminary findings suggest that the incident was not spontaneous, but the result of a well-planned operation executed over a period of time.
‘Maintain Silence’ Instructions Before Arrest : Crime Branch sources also disclosed that Golu Pandit had been instructed in advance to remain silent if apprehended by the police. Following the arrest of shooters in Haryana, the gang anticipated that Pandit could be the next target of law enforcement action.
It is alleged that jailed gangster Lawrence Bishnoi conveyed a message through Arju Bishnoi, directing Golu Pandit not to reveal any information about other members of the syndicate under any circumstances. As a result, despite nearly 12 days of police custody, investigators have reportedly been unable to extract significant additional information from him.

Dhurandhar 2 Box Office Collection Day 9: Ranveer Singh Starrer Earns ₹41.55 Crore On Its Second Friday; Enters ₹700 Crore Club

Ranveer Singh starrer Dhurandhar The Revenge, in just nine days, has entered the Rs. 700 crore club. The film took a fantastic opening and had an amazing first extended weekend. Even on weekdays, it performed very well, and although it showed a drop in collections on its second Friday, the movie has still collected a very good amount.
According to Sacnilk, on its ninth day, Dhurandhar 2 collected Rs. 41.55 crore, taking the total to Rs. 715.72 crore, which is an exceptional amount. The Aditya Dhar directorial has already left films like Jawan, Chhaava, Stree 2, and others behind at the box office in just a few days.
Its next aim is to cross the lifetime collection of SS Rajamouli’s RRR, which had collected Rs. 782.20 crore. Currently, Dhurandhar 2 is at the sixth position when it comes to the highest-grossing Indian film, and at the second spot when it comes to the highest-grossing Hindi film.
Dhurandhar part 1 had collected Rs. 840 crore, and it is the highest-grossing Hindi film till now. It is expected that Dhurandhar 2 will surpass the lifetime collection of Dhurandhar 1 and become the highest-grossing Bollywood film to date.
Dhurandhar 2 Rs. 1000 Crore Club
When it comes to the worldwide gross box office collection, Dhurandhar 2 has already crossed the Rs. 1000 crore mark. It has collected Rs. 1,128.99 gross worldwide.
However, the trade is expecting that the Ranveer Singh starrer will mint more than Rs. 1000 crore net at the box office in India.
Will Dhurandhar 2 Beat Pushpa 2?
Till now, Aalu Arjun starrer Pushpa 2 The Rule is the highest-grossing Indian film if we look at the net collection in India. The film had minted Rs. 1,234.10 crore at the box office. So, let’s wait and watch whether Dhurandhar 2 will be able to beat Pushpa 2 or not.
